Voltage withstand test for inverters is a high voltage test performed on inverters to evaluate their insulation and voltage withstand capability. The test is designed to determine the insulation capability of the inverter under normal operation and abnormal conditions to ensure its safe and. . An inverter is one of the most important pieces of equipment in a solar energy system. It's a device that converts direct current (DC) electricity, which is what a solar panel generates, to alternating current (AC) electricity, which the electrical grid uses. In DC, electricity is maintained at. . Power quality control: Active controls reduce electrical noise and harmonics so your devices see stable voltage and a clean waveform. How many batteries do you need for a solar energy system?
Suppose you consume 30 kWh daily. If you choose a lithium-ion battery with a usable capacity of 10 kWh and a DoD of 90%, you'll need at least three batteries to meet your daily needs. Which battery is best for a solar inverter?
Today's home battery systems typically use LFP or NMC lithium battery for solar inverter applications. Favor high usable DoD (≈80–100%), robust cycle warranties, and a system that's UL 9540 listed and installed per NFPA 855 and NEC 705/706.
